隨筆 - 4, 文章 - 0, 評論 - 0, 引用 - 0
          數據加載中……

          簡單的MD5加密

          package com.MD5;
          import java.security.*;

          import java.security.spec.*;


          public class MD5{

          public static String getMD5(String s){

             char hexDigits[] = {'0','1','2','3','4','5','6','7','8','9','a','b','c','d','e','f'};
             try
             {
              byte[] strTemp = s.getBytes();
              MessageDigest mdTemp = MessageDigest.getInstance("MD5");
              mdTemp.update(strTemp);
              byte[] md = mdTemp.digest();
              int j = md.length;
              char str[] = new char[j*2];
              int k = 0;
              for (int i = 0; i < j; i++)
              {
               byte byte0 = md[i];
               str[k++] = hexDigits[byte0 >>> 4 & 0xf];
               str[k++] = hexDigits[byte0 & 0xf];
              }
              return new String(str);
             }
             catch (Exception e)
             {
              return null;
             }
          }
          public static void main(String[] args)
          {
            

             System.out.print(MD5.getMD5("張三"));

          }
          }

          posted on 2007-08-30 17:51 心月狐 閱讀(182) 評論(0)  編輯  收藏 所屬分類: java


          只有注冊用戶登錄后才能發表評論。


          網站導航:
           
          主站蜘蛛池模板: 长武县| 偃师市| 阳城县| 武穴市| 莱芜市| 兴宁市| 平潭县| 石首市| 蛟河市| 东源县| 临清市| 老河口市| 梅河口市| 康保县| 北安市| 斗六市| 毕节市| 牙克石市| 周口市| 洞口县| 合阳县| 佳木斯市| 天台县| 肇源县| 新蔡县| 安岳县| 荃湾区| 奉贤区| 徐汇区| 鱼台县| 峨边| 普兰店市| 洪洞县| 南川市| 保靖县| 全南县| 曲阜市| 荥阳市| 鄂托克前旗| 南部县| 达州市|